    Houston vs. Wisconsin line, predictions: College basketball odds and picks for Tuesday's matchup from proven computer model

    Sportsline's projection model has generated its selections for Tuesday's meeting in the 2021 Maui Invitational in Las Vegas

    The Wisconsin Badgers (3-1) and the 12th-ranked Houston Cougars (4-0) face off Tuesday in the semifinals of the 2021 Maui Invitational in Las Vegas after surprisingly easy victories in Monday's openers. 

    Tipoff is set for 5 p.m. ET at Mandalay Bay Events Center. The Cougars are the 7.5-point favorites in the latest Houston vs. Wisconsin  college basketball odds from Caesars Sportsbook, while the Over-Under is set at 122.5.

    The model has taken into account that the Cougars allow just 55 points per game. That number is skewed by an overtime victory against Hofstra in the opener, and they are allowing 48.3 points in the last three. Fabian White led Houston with 21 points and eight rebounds Monday as leading scorer Marcus Sasser had a quiet nine-point outing. The Cougars forced 20 turnovers, had 11 steals and blocked four shots while turning it over just 10 times. 

    The simulations also have taken into account that the Wisconsin duo of Brad Davison and Johnny Davis are dangerous. They showed that again Monday, as Davis scored 21 and Davison had 19 against the Aggies. The Badgers fell into an early 16-4 hole, but they were resilient and disciplined in turning the tables. Wisconsin has size inside with 7-footer Steven Crowl and 6-9 Tyler Wahl, who combine for an average of almost 19 points and 11 rebounds.
